Guillain-Barre Syndrome in A Patient with Infectious Endocarditis: Clinical Observation and Literature Review
Guillain-Barré Syndrome is a severe autoimmune disease of the peripheral nervous system, representing the most common cause of acute flaccid tetraparesis, which can lead to life-threatening respiratory failure in the absence of adequate therapy.
